Bilateral Labor Agreements and Social Security Agreements

The report is CMA’s initial project to better understand and closely examine processes, approaches and contents of BLAs and SSAs and their potential as effective mechanisms to enhance protection of the rights of Filipino migrant workers. We would like to share the report’s observations, analyses and recommendations to our government negotiators and policy makers, the OFWs and fellow advocates in the hopes that we can all be active stakeholders in initiating, developing, and negotiating human rights-based, gender-sensitive BLAs and SSAs.
